Man charged after serious knife attack in Dundalk

A man has been charged in connection with a serious knife attack on another man in Co Louth over the weekend.

The 19-year-old victim received hundreds of stitches after he was slashed in the face and body in Dundalk in the early hours of Sunday morning.

A 25-year-old man who was arrested in connection with the attack last night has been charged with assault causing harm.

He has been released on bail to appear before Dundalk District Court tomorrow.
